So now PZ getting thrown out of Expelled (and Dawkins getting in) triggers New York Times coverage. If you ask me, this really helps the Expelled people, who want nothing more than controversy. And Dawkins completely doesn't get it:

Dr. Dawkins said the hoopla has been "a gift" to those who oppose creationism. "We could not ask for anything better," he said.

How exactly does that work? How does "hoopla" over an anti-evolution movie help the cause of opposing creationism? No, I suspect this is a gift to Expelled, a gift to Ben Stein. The controversy raises the profile of the movie, people--especially a movie like this, which is by its very nature courting controversy and baiting evolutionists. Why is that hard to understand?
